  <dc:description xmlns:geonet="http://www.fao.org/geonetwork">Many different datasets will be produced, such as:
* Regional Climate Model (RCM, 12km) downscaling from NZ  Earth System Model global simulations, for ensemble of initial conditions and future forcing (with UM)
* Very-high resolution (1.5km) experimental data sets for sub-NZ domains (with UM)
* High resolution (4km) experimental simulations with CSIRO CCAM model
* Statistically downscaled RCM data onto 5km VCSN grid of the above simulations
* NZ Drought Index and its 4 component indices on VCSN 5km grid for CMIP5 simulations (6 models, 4 RCPs)</dc:description>
